The Stucchi Ball Quick Couplings are available in IR and IV-HP series, with ball or screw locking systems. Made of carbon steel, they withstand pressures up to 700 bar and temperatures from -20 °C to +100 °C. Compatible with BSP and NPT threads, they include versions with NBR and PTFE seals. Ideal for hydraulic high-pressure use and complex industrial applications.
The Stucchi Ball Quick Couplings include two distinct series: IR Series, interchangeable ISO 7241-1 “A” in 1/2” size, and IV-HP Series, designed for high-pressure applications.
The IR Series quick couplings feature a ball locking and shut-off system with single-action sleeve. Coupling and uncoupling are not allowed under pressure. The hardened steel ball valves improve wear resistance. The overall dimensions are compact.

Technical features:
Locking system: single-action sleeve.
Shut-off system: ball type.
Material: high strength carbon steel.
Available threads: BSP, NPT.
Seals: NBR nitrile.
Working temperature: from -20 °C to +100 °C.
Available sizes: 1/4″, 3/8″, 1/2″, 3/4″, 1″.
Max flow: up to 150 l/min.
Working pressure: up to 300 bar.
Spillage: from 0.13 ml (1/4″) to 6.00 ml (1″).
TIC Version (only for 1/2″): mushroom-type coupling with shielded valve that reduces “flow checking” effect when used with a connection under pressure.
The IV-HP Series couplings have a screw-type locking and shut-off system. Coupling/uncoupling is not allowed under pressure. They are designed for high-pressure applications.

Technical features:
Locking system: screw type.
Shut-off system: screw type.
Material: high strength carbon steel.
Available threads: NPT.
Seals: NBR nitrile; in 3/8” size there is a PTFE back-up ring.
Working temperature: from -20 °C to +100 °C.
Available sizes: 1/4″, 3/8″.
Max flow: 12 l/min (1/4″), 23 l/min (3/8″).
Working pressure: 700 bar (10,000 psi).

Series | Available sizes | Max pressure (bar) | Max flow (l/min) | Locking system | Available threads | Seals | Interchangeability | Working temperature (°C) |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
IR | 1/4″, 3/8″, 1/2″, 3/4″, 1″ | 300 | Up to 150 | Single-action sleeve | BSP, NPT | NBR | ISO 7241-1 “A” (only 1/2”) | -20 / +100 |
IR-TIC | 1/2″ | 300 | 90 | Single-action sleeve, with shielded mushroom | BSP, NPT | NBR | ISO 7241-1 “A” | -20 / +100 |
IV-HP | 1/4″, 3/8″ | 700 | Up to 23 | Screw type | NPT | NBR (1/4”), NBR + PTFE (3/8”) | With similar couplings (High pressure) | -20 / +100 |
